MAINTENANCE - Faced with the failure of the negotiations with Tehran, the United States is in the process of changing its strategy, says Thierry Coville, researcher at the Institute for International and Strategic Relations (IRIS) and specialist in Iran.
With much fanfare, the US has announced an economic punitive expedition against Iran. For Washington, this new step underscores two painful truths. The military campaign has proven insufficient, and President Donald Trump's claim that Tehran is begging for a deal remains wishful thinking for the time being.
The scale and effectiveness of the new sanctions are open, and an essential issue is unresolved.
Donald Trump is counting on an economic war against Iran. But analysts warn: the mullahs have survived sanctions before.
